Dog Childcare Vs Pet Dog Park
Pet dog day care offers your animal with regular socializing in a risk-free and controlled environment. This can help them to construct trust fund, discover how to connect with pets of all sizes and personalities, and pick up on canine body movement.


While pet dog parks may appear like a terrific place for your puppy to burn some energy, they have many concealed threats.

Security
Pet parks and pet childcare are both great rooms for puppies to exercise and socialize, however they differ in safety attributes. Pet park atmospheres are uncertain, and a bad experience can have lasting results on your pet dog's confidence and actions.

Dog childcare uses a safe and organized environment, where pet dogs are placed in groups that match their personalities. The center has experienced personnel who check play to avoid injuries. Although battles do take place occasionally, they are typically small and are not a result of hostility.

One more security function of dog day care is that workers are responsible for implementing policies and making certain that pets are vaccinated. This is necessary because pet dogs in without supervision settings might be exposed to microorganisms in feces or alcohol consumption water, and this can lead to conditions like kennel coughing, giardia, fleas, and other bloodsuckers. They may additionally be subjected to aggressive pet dogs, which can create serious damage to pups and young adults.

Socializing
Pet parks use the best off-leash environment for canines to launch energy and socialize with various other pets. They also supply a great area for dogs to exercise, which is an integral part of their overall wellness. Pet childcares, on the other hand, offer a much more organized and secure atmosphere for your family pet to connect with other pets in a more controlled way.

Dogs that are not exposed to other dogs in a favorable means frequently may create anti-social habits which can materialize as fear, anxiousness or aggression towards other animals. Dogs that spend time at the dog park typically just recognize one setting of communication with other canines-- high drive play until they are exhausted.

When canines satisfy at a pet dog park, the greetings are normally frenzied with each dog rushing to reach the various other. This can cause scuffles or battles. At a well-run day care, first greetings are normally smelling butts and the employees stay in control of the interaction guaranteeing no scuffles occur.

Atmosphere
Dog parks supply exterior play in a natural setup, which supplies physical exercise and possibilities for canines to engage in their all-natural habits like smelling and running. This can help reduce anxiousness, promote socializing, and enhance mental excitement.

Nevertheless, outdoor play areas are prone to disease-spreading problems such as looseness of the bowels and Giardia as a result of route call in between pets. Additionally, the environment may not be clean enough to prevent contamination from canines' feces or urine.

At day care, the centers are cleansed on a regular basis and sanitized often to lessen these risks. Furthermore, professional daycares separate canines based on size, temperament, and playing design to stop hazardous communications. Pets that have no organized tasks in your home can experience monotony, which often results in behavior issues such as extreme barking and chewing. Day care supplies an active, interesting setting that networks dogs' energy into favorable tasks and enhances their habits in the house and in public setups. It additionally helps to alleviate splitting up stress and anxiety and tension in homes with animals that are left alone throughout the day.
